Qualification
- MBBS from a recognized medical college
- MD (General Medicine) followed by DM (Medical Gastroenterology)
- Registration with the National Medical Commission (NMC)/State Medical Council
- Freshers and experienced candidates are welcome to apply
Job Summary
We are looking for a dedicated and compassionate Medical Gastroenterologist to diagnose, treat, and manage diseases related to the digestive system, liver, pancreas, gallbladder, and gastrointestinal tract. The ideal candidate should possess strong clinical knowledge, excellent patient care skills, and the ability to perform diagnostic and therapeutic endoscopic procedures.
Key Responsibilities
- Evaluate, diagnose, and treat patients with gastrointestinal and liver disorders.
- Perform diagnostic and therapeutic procedures such as:
- Upper GI Endoscopy
- Colonoscopy
- Sigmoidoscopy
- ERCP (if trained)
- Capsule Endoscopy (where available)
- Manage conditions including:
- GERD
- Peptic Ulcer Disease
- Irritable Bowel Syndrome (IBS)
- Inflammatory Bowel Disease (IBD)
- Liver Diseases
- Hepatitis
- Pancreatitis
- GI Bleeding
- Gastrointestinal Cancers
- Interpret laboratory investigations, imaging studies, and pathology reports.
- Develop individualized treatment plans and monitor patient progress.
- Provide inpatient and outpatient consultation services.
- Collaborate with surgeons, oncologists, radiologists, and other specialists.
- Educate patients and families regarding disease prevention, treatment, and lifestyle modifications.
- Maintain accurate and timely medical records.
- Participate in emergency GI care whenever required.
- Ensure adherence to hospital protocols, infection control measures, and ethical medical practices.
